Anmol Gagan Mann visits illegal mining spots In Anandpur Sahib area

Captain has now taken over command of mining mafia which started during Akalis: Anmol Gagan Mann

The Aam Aadmi Party's (AAP) Youth Wing co-president Anmol Gagan Mann visited mining spots with deep pits dug by the mining mafia in Anandpur Sahib area on Tuesday. After reaching the site of the struggle of the locals against the mining mafia in the village of Ailgran, Anmol Gagan Mann visited the villages of Harsa Bela, Dulchi Patti, Bhallan, Sainsowal and Nangran, where mining was done illegally under patronage of the government. On the occasion, she said that mafia rule was going on in Punjab at present and Punjab Chief Minister Captain Amarinder Singh, being power drunk, did not see anything. She said that before coming to power Captain Amarinder Singh had promised the people to end all forms of mafias in Punjab by holding Sri Gutka Sahib in his hands but after coming to power, he reneged on all his promises.She further said that the mining mafia had dug 100-100 feet deep pits but the local administration was asleep and could not see anything. She said that whenever it was opposed by the locals, they were attacked by goons kept by the mafia. "We arrived here today on the invitation of the locals and saw how the mining mafia was flourishing in the area. Deep pits were dug and illegal mining is rampant with the help of the government," she said. The AAP leader further said that farmers' stubble burning could be seen through the satellite and notices were issued by the administration, but when people close to the government run such mafias, they could not be seen by the authorities. She said that the mafia rule would be eradicated from the state after the formation of the Aam Aadmi Party government.
